支持应用程序的持久性和启动服务

时间:2012-09-29 11:22:48

标签: android

我拥有一台Android 4.0.3平板电脑,我正在使用Java / SDK进行编程,仍未尝试使用NDK。 现在,假设您要对此平板电脑进行编程以将其置于服务点,使用单个用例(如餐厅),它将显示菜单并让用户传递它们。我不想让用户关闭这个软件。此外,它必须自动运行在平板电脑启动和持久性运行,即如果由于某种原因关闭,平板电脑不应该返回其标准GUI,而是重新启动此应用程序。

我不知道这有什么起点,比如一些关键字等。我想在这里我必须编写一个服务(维护应用程序的持久性和启动性)和应用程序本身。

你能否提出一些想法/关键词/潜在的起点/评论?

提前谢谢。

2 个答案:

答案 0 :(得分:0)

这里有一些你需要检查的事项:

1.。)如何在启动时启动应用程序。

2.。)如何在后台运行服务/线程以检查应用程序是否正在运行以及是否启动它。

3.。)如何停用按钮,例如像“后退”按钮一样不退出应用程序或编程活动永远不会因用户干扰而退出。 (虽然这是非常糟糕的做法!):)

4。)出于维护目的,应该有办法退出应用程序。要有创意。也许只能用密码或其他东西退出。

答案 1 :(得分:0)

  

我不想让用户关闭此软件,因此必须坚持使用。

让它成为主屏幕。

  

此外,它必须在平板电脑启动时自动运行并且持续运行,即如果由于某种原因关闭,平板电脑不应该返回其标准GUI,而是重新启动此应用程序并代表其GUI。

让它成为主屏幕。